Easy to distress or antique
Brown painted furniture is incredibly easy to distress or antique, which can add a touch of character and charm to any piece. Distressing involves creating a worn and aged look, while antiquing involves creating a more refined and elegant look.
- Sanding
One of the simplest ways to distress brown painted furniture is to sand it. This will create a worn and aged look, and can be used to highlight the natural grain of the wood. You can use a sanding block or sandpaper, and start with a coarse grit and gradually move to a finer grit to create a smoother finish.
- Chipping
Another way to distress brown painted furniture is to chip it. This can be done by using a hammer and chisel, or by using a sharp object to create small chips in the paint. Chipping can create a more rustic and distressed look, and can be used to add character to a piece of furniture.
- Glazing
Glazing is a technique that can be used to create an antiqued look on brown painted furniture. This involves applying a thin layer of glaze over the paint, which will create a darker, richer finish. You can use a variety of different glazes to create different effects, and you can experiment with different techniques to create a unique look.
- Waxing
Waxing is a great way to protect and seal brown painted furniture, and it can also be used to create an antiqued look. Applying a thin layer of wax over the paint will help to protect it from wear and tear, and it will also give it a soft, matte finish. You can use a variety of different waxes to create different effects, and you can experiment with different techniques to create a unique look.

Question 1: What is the best type of paint to use for brown painted furniture?
Answer: The best type of paint to use for brown painted furniture is a durable, water-based paint. This type of paint will provide a long-lasting finish that is resistant to scratches and stains.
Question 2: How do I prepare furniture for painting?
Answer: Before you start painting, it is important to prepare the furniture properly. This involves cleaning the furniture to remove any dirt or debris, and sanding it to smooth out any rough edges.
Question 3: How many coats of paint should I apply?
Answer: It is best to apply two or three coats of paint to ensure a durable and even finish. Allow each coat to dry completely before applying the next.
Question 4: Can I distress or antique brown painted furniture?
Answer: Yes, you can distress or antique brown painted furniture to give it a unique and aged look. There are a variety of techniques that you can use to achieve this, such as sanding, chipping, and glazing.
Question 5: How do I care for brown painted furniture?
Answer: To care for brown painted furniture, simply wipe it down with a damp cloth and mild soap.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ners, as these can damage the paint finish.
Question 6: Can I paint outdoor furniture brown?
Answer: Yes, you can paint outdoor furniture brown. However, it is important to use a paint that is specifically designed for outdoor use. This type of paint will be able to withstand the elements and will not fade or peel.
